    Make TBB work on KDE 4
    
    On KDE 4 desktops, Qt apps try to load the KDE 4 style called Oxygen.
    This causes a few other Qt shared libs to be loaded, and we don't ship
    them all, which causes a crash. Tomásfound this cool solution, which
    means we don't have to ship more libraries than we do now. Basically we
    tell Vidalia to bypass auto-detecting a style and just pre-pick a sane
    one. If the user manually overrides this, Vidalia will still crash, but
    this should work for the vast majority of users for now.
    
    Works around bug 5214.
